MPC Capital Divests Largest Solar Plant in Jamaica

On April 16, 2025, MPC Münchmeyer Petersen Capital AG announced the sale of Jamaica's largest solar power facility, Paradise Park. This 51 MWp solar park was transferred from MPC Caribbean Clean Energy Limited to InterEnergy Group. Situated in Jamaica, Paradise Park was initiated in 2019 and marked MPC Capital's first Caribbean venture, pivotal for Jamaica's energy sustainability objectives. Neoen, alongside French and Dutch development banks, PROPARCO and FMO, collaborated in the project.

Dr. Philipp Lauenstein, CFO of MPC Capital, highlighted the project's significance, noting its comprehensive management from inception to sale. MPC Capital continues its focus on infrastructure investment, contributing to global climate objectives with assets totaling EUR 5.1 billion.
